My first project features the new Twine & Bows Dies (new stock has just been added to the Pretty Pink Posh Store – get this die set quickly before it sells out again!).  First, I just want to mention how GENIUS I think this die set is!!  Like, seriously?!!  So flippin’ brilliant!!  I was curious to see if I could use it to die cut diagonal striped patterned paper to make the die cut look like actual baker’s twine – and it worked!!  BOOM!!  So many possibilities!!  That sweet scalloped border was created with another of the Pretty Pink Posh die sets called Stitched Borders 2.  And, of course, I’ve sprinkled some of my fave Sparkling Clear Sequins to embellish!

My second project features the new Storybook 1 Die.  Again, this is such a versatile and clever die that I think has so many design options!!  I used it here to surround the sentiment and to provide a frame for the embossed watercolor flowers.  The stitched detail that surrounds the Storybook 1 Die is amazing!!  I used the new Lavender Moon Sequins to embellish the card – they are so dreamy!!
